75966
ZIP 75966 has notably lower household income than the US average, with a median household income of $40,087. Population has held roughly steady since 2024. 8%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, below the national rate of 36%. Median home value is $102,900. The poverty rate of 23.0% is well above the national figure. Among the 5 ZIP codes in Newton County, 75966 ranks 2nd by median household income.
How many people live in ZIP code 75966?
ZIP code 75966 has about 4,994 residents according to the 2024 American Community Survey.
What is the median household income in ZIP code 75966?
The typical household in ZIP code 75966 earns about $40,087 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.
Is ZIP code 75966 expensive?
In ZIP code 75966, the median home is worth about $102,900, and the typical rent is about $1,049 a month.
How educated are people in ZIP code 75966?
About 7.7% of adults age 25 and over in ZIP code 75966 hold a bachelor's degree or higher.
What is the poverty rate in ZIP code 75966?
About 23.0% of people in ZIP code 75966 live below the federal poverty line.
